Morningstar (MORN) Total Liabilities: 2009-2025

Historic Total Liabilities for Morningstar (MORN) over the last 16 years, with Sep 2025 value amounting to $2.0 billion.

  • Morningstar's Total Liabilities rose 2.15% to $2.0 billion in Q3 2025 from the same period last year, while for Sep 2025 it was $2.0 billion, marking a year-over-year increase of 2.15%. This contributed to the annual value of $1.9 billion for FY2024, which is 7.00% down from last year.
  • According to the latest figures from Q3 2025, Morningstar's Total Liabilities is $2.0 billion, which was up 1.37% from $2.0 billion recorded in Q2 2025.
  • In the past 5 years, Morningstar's Total Liabilities ranged from a high of $2.3 billion in Q4 2022 and a low of $1.4 billion during Q1 2021.
  • Over the past 3 years, Morningstar's median Total Liabilities value was $2.0 billion (recorded in 2025), while the average stood at $2.1 billion.
  • As far as peak fluctuations go, Morningstar's Total Liabilities surged by 64.55% in 2022, and later decreased by 11.36% in 2024.
  • Morningstar's Total Liabilities (Quarterly) stood at $1.4 billion in 2021, then skyrocketed by 56.74% to $2.3 billion in 2022, then decreased by 8.47% to $2.1 billion in 2023, then decreased by 7.00% to $1.9 billion in 2024, then increased by 2.15% to $2.0 billion in 2025.
  • Its last three reported values are $2.0 billion in Q3 2025, $2.0 billion for Q2 2025, and $2.0 billion during Q1 2025.
